Understanding the Basics of Twist Lock Lighting
To fully appreciate twist lock lighting, one must first grasp its fundamental principles. Twist lock lighting refers to a type of electrical connection that allows lighting fixtures to be quickly and securely mounted. The design enables users to easily connect and disconnect lights, making it ideal for applications that require flexibility and ease of use.
The Concept Behind Twist Lock Lighting
The concept of twist lock lighting revolves around a secure and reliable electrical connection. This system typically features a locking mechanism that ensures the light fixture is firmly anchored in place. When a fixture is twisted into the base, it engages the locking mechanism, allowing the device to maintain a firm connection while providing power to the lamp.
This design not only enhances safety but also improves the efficiency of light installations. Given its user-friendly nature, twist lock systems are often employed in venues that host events, outdoor spaces, and locations requiring frequent changes in lighting setup. For instance, in concert venues, where lighting arrangements may need to change rapidly to adapt to different performances, twist lock lighting provides the versatility and speed necessary for quick adjustments. This adaptability is crucial in ensuring that the ambiance can be tailored to fit the mood of each act, enhancing the overall experience for both performers and audiences alike.
Key Components of Twist Lock Lighting
Key components that make up a twist lock lighting system include the light fixture, the twist lock base, and the electrical connector. Each part plays a vital role in facilitating a seamless integration between the electrical source and the lighting element.
- Light Fixture: This is the component that houses the light source, such as LED or halogen bulbs. It comes in various designs and styles to meet different aesthetic and functional needs.
- Twist Lock Base: The twist lock base is the mounting point that connects the light fixture to the power supply. It is designed to accept a specific type of connector that matches the fixture.
- Electrical Connector: The electrical connector is the interface that allows electricity to flow from the power source to the light fixture, ensuring illumination.
In addition to these components, the materials used in the construction of twist lock systems are equally important. High-quality plastics and metals are often employed to ensure durability and resistance to environmental factors, especially in outdoor settings where exposure to moisture and temperature fluctuations can be a concern. Furthermore, advancements in technology have led to the development of twist lock systems that are not only more robust but also more energy-efficient. For example, modern LED fixtures designed for twist lock connections can significantly reduce energy consumption while providing superior lighting performance, making them an excellent choice for both commercial and residential applications.

How Twist Lock Lighting Works
At the heart of any twist lock lighting system is the principle of electrical conductivity. When a light fixture is twisted into place, the connectors on both the fixture and base come into contact, allowing electricity to flow.
This system is designed with safety in mind, producing a tight connection that minimizes the risk of electrical failures or short circuits. The twist mechanism also ensures that the fixture remains secured, even in outdoor environments where vibration or movement may occur. Additionally, the design often incorporates weather-resistant materials, making it suitable for various applications, from residential patios to commercial outdoor spaces. This versatility allows for seamless integration into different environments, enhancing both functionality and aesthetics.

Choosing the Right Twist Lock Lighting
When it comes to selecting twist lock lighting, several factors deserve consideration to ensure optimal performance and satisfaction with the installation.
Factors to Consider When Selecting Twist Lock Lighting
Key factors to keep in mind while choosing twist lock lighting include:
- Application: Consider where the lighting will be used. Different environments may require specific features, such as moisture resistance or additional security.
- Brightness Requirements: Select fixtures that provide adequate luminosity for your needs, whether for general illumination or spotlighting.
- Energy Efficiency Ratings: Determine the energy efficiency of available options, prioritizing those that utilize less power without compromising performance.
Understanding Different Types of Twist Lock Lighting
Familiarizing yourself with the types of twist lock lighting can also guide your decision. Common types include:
- Portable light fixtures: These are ideal for temporary installations at events or construction sites.
- Permanent mount fixtures: Designed for long-term use, these fixtures are suitable for installed outdoor lighting or permanent displays.
- Architectural lighting: Tailored designs that fit specific aesthetic requirements in commercial or residential spaces.
